Baixe o app para aproveitar ainda mais
Prévia do material em texto
A Nome p au lo r i c a r do v i a na Análise e Projeto - Tema 9 Nota 1. Que tipos de requisitos são críticos para a definição da arquitetura de software? Requisitos funcionais Requisitos não funcionais Requisitos legais Requisitos abstratos 2. Um desenvolvedor de sistemas, utilizando a UML para descrever um software, precisa usar um diagrama que apresente pedaços do software, divididos em agrupamentos lógicos, mostrando as dependências entre eles, de modo que, se apresente a arquitetura do software apontando o agrupamento de suas classes. Esse diagrama é denominado, na UML, de diagrama de: componentes. sequência. atividades. pacotes. 3. Com relação a engenharia de software, julgue os itens que se seguem. "A escolha adequada da arquitetura de um software contribui para facilitar a implementação, o teste e a manutenção, quando necessária, de um sistema." Verdadeiro Falso 4. No que concerne à análise e ao projeto de software, julgue os próximos itens. "Requisitos não funcionais do sistema podem influenciar o estilo e a estrutura escolhida para uma aplicação, pois a arquitetura de sistema afeta seu desempenho, sua distribuição e manutenção." Verdadeiro Falso B C D A B C D V F V F 5. A arquitetura de software de um sistema é a estrutura do sistema, que compreende os elementos, as relações entre eles, e as propriedades desses elementos e relações que são visíveis externamente. A linguagem UML pode ser utilizada para modelar e documentar arquiteturas de software por meio de diagramas. Dentre eles, os principais diagramas que permitem modelar os aspectos físicos de um sistema orientado a objetos são diagramas de Estados e Diagrama de Atividades. Classe e de Casos de Uso. Componentes e de Objetos. Implantação e de Artefatos. 6. O diagrama de componentes da UML, que enfoca detalhes de um software, é um tipo especial de diagrama de classes. sequência. atividades. colaboração. 7. A respeito da UML (unified modeling language), julgue os próximos itens. O diagrama de componentes deve ser utilizado para se representar a configuração e a arquitetura de um sistema no qual estarão ligados todos os software e hardware, bem como sua interação com outros elementos de suporte ao processamento. Verdadeiro Falso 8. A classe de componentes em UML que permite modelar recursos (que incluem gráficos e áudios) e pacotes (que são grupos de classes) que constituem o software é o diagrama de: classes. componentes. colaborações. casos de uso. 9. Julgue o item: "Com a utilização do diagrama de componentes da UML (unified modeling language) podem ser modelados os processos de negócio da empresa" Verdadeiro Falso A B C D A B C D V F A B C D V F A 10. A principal função de um Diagrama de Componentes, segundo a UML 2.0, é: determinar o plano para implantação de um sistema em ambiente de produção; permitir a visualização da estrutura de alto nível do sistema e o comportamento dos serviços que os componentes de software provêm e/ou consomem; determinar, junto com o diagrama de Caso de Uso, os requisitos funcionais de um sistema e a sequência de execução dos componentes que o compõem; determinar as características básicas sobre o comportamento de um sistema. B C D
Compartilhar